Transaction 42e20e75455721916375424423241751da7cf13ec37839876ae3f4aa94117995

1 Input
2 Outputs
  • 42e20e75455721916375424423241751da7cf13ec37839876ae3f4aa94117995:0
  • value  1487775
    address  bc1qn28f93m5qkc56kpf33hc9u8yf024wsjw6988qk
  • 42e20e75455721916375424423241751da7cf13ec37839876ae3f4aa94117995:1
  • value  3917050
    address  3L1URZy1XEpBdBaw61k7p6PRRKcbBB8wiB